TMP421AIDCNT Features
Moisture Sensitivity Level (MSL): 2 (1 Year)
Tape & Reel (TR) Package
Operating Temperature: -40°C~125°C
Supply Voltage: 2.7V~5.5V
8 Pins
Local Sensing Temperature: -40°C~125°C
8 Terminations
Highest (Lowest) Accuracy: ±1.5°C (±2.5°C)
Sensor Type: Digital, Local/Remote
